9/29 Janeane Garofalo Returns!

September 29, 2015

The great Janeane Garofalo talks about the Marc Maron monologue and why she does not listen to Podcasts. Janeane and Sam talk about how to pronounce words. Are comedians getting more political? Why student loans will force more young people into politics. Inspiration from Jeremy Corbyn. School fundraising and economic segregation. Are we at a tipping point? Donald Trump does not want to be President. The GOP’s probable next leader Tom Price know nothing about women’s healthcare (surprise, surprise). What happened to Ann Coulter? And how Janeane’s conservative dad feels about Pope Francis.

On The Fun Half: Rush Limbaugh says new discovery of water on Mars might be part of a global warming hoax by NASA. Breitbart “blows the lid” on Ahmed the clock maker Muslim boy. The evolving nature of media discourse in America. Sam debates a Libertarian. Also your calls and IMs.
